Why no discussion of the privacy and security implications? No WPA3, but Ubiquiti said in Feb 2020 that it's "coming soon" and they haven't applied for certification but "they'll be ready" when WPA3 is required; spoiler alert - it's been required for certification by the WiFi Allliance since July 2020. They've been silent on this for months. Some features of UDM also require remote access to user data: possibly Threat Management (like Asus AiProtection), and a UniFi account is REQUIRED to even use this thing. I think the Alien Router you're talking about is part of Ubiquiti's AmpliFi line which is the home user version. It's meant to be simple for the average user. The Ubiquiti's UniFi line is meant for advanced users and small businesses so it offers more settings for security and management features. The Dream Machine is part of that UniFi line. This year, I noticed Ubiquity released a thing they called Unify Dream Router. This is supposed to be Dream Machine's successor. But I have also noticed that Dream Router has fewer features than the Dream Machine. I will mostly focus on security, and support for multiple VLANs. It would be great to hear from this community different opinions on each of these products. Maybe a comparison video could be done. The one's I've seen on other channels is quite superficial with no in-depth information.
I am here because I was just looking at the two. I LOVED that the router has two POE ports in it, but it has some big issues. It is apparently loud, like the cooling system is loud... The bigger issue that can't do full 1Gbps speeds. The CPU in it is apparently trash and throttles to about 650Mbps, that is a deal breaker for me. Instead I just picked up a used Dream Machine and POE Switch.
